With a fortunate position at the top of New Zealand's North Island, Auckland boasts both the Tasman and Pacific Sea, where surfers can indulge their passion. Walkers have some of the most fabulous rainforest land to explore and foodies have the avant-garde cuisine of the modern city.
The surrounding islands are very popular for day trips and it's no wonder why. Natural conservation projects on Tiritiri Matangi are a wonderful way to preserve New Zealand's unique habitat. Superb hiking on Rangitoto Island offers scenic views on an uninhabited island.
Beautiful beaches can be found on Great Barrier Island, a largely untouched island where locals come to escape the city and relax. Be sure to test out your hiking boots and walk to the hot springs where you can take a dip. Spend your evening enjoying the fruits of the local fisherman's labour with exquisite meals prepared in the bistros of the island.
Auckland Airport (AKL)
Flights from Australia to Auckland will disembark at Auckland Airport.
Auckland Airport (AKL) is New Zealand's busiest airport, hosting more than 13 million passengers a year. It is the main international gateway for New Zealand's North Island. The airport consists of an international terminal and a domestic terminal.
